Bolivia Pivot: Government Evaluates Integrating USDT into National Financial System

Bolivia is executing a massive strategic pivot regarding digital assets. Economy Minister Jose Gabriel Espinoza has announced that the government is evaluating the inclusion and circulation of the USDT stablecoin within the national payment system, potentially allowing the asset to be used for settling state debts.
This move follows a significant reversal of previous crypto bans, as the nation races to modernize its financial infrastructure. By integrating USDT, Bolivia aims to leverage stablecoin liquidity to navigate economic challenges and establish a foothold in the rapidly evolving global digital economy.
Following the reversal of its previous crypto ban, Bolivia is racing to reposition itself within the digital asset landscape. The potential integration of a dollar-pegged stablecoin into the official financial framework marks a decisive shift in the country's economic policy, aiming for greater stability and global connectivity.
